[发明专利]一种云存储标签隐私保护的数据完整性检测方法及系统有效
| 申请号: | 202010386096.5 | 申请日: | 2020-05-09 |
| 公开(公告)号: | CN111539031B | 公开(公告)日: | 2023-04-18 |
| 发明(设计)人: | 张明武;韩波;刘忆宁 | 申请(专利权)人: | 桂林电子科技大学 |
| 主分类号: | G06F21/64 | 分类号: | G06F21/64;G06F21/62;H04L9/08;H04L67/1097 |
| 代理公司: | 北京高沃律师事务所 11569 | 代理人: | 杜阳阳 |
| 地址: | 541004 广西*** | 国省代码: | 广西;45 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 存储 标签 隐私 保护 数据 完整性 检测 方法 系统 | ||
1.一种云存储标签隐私保护的数据完整性检测方法,其特征在于,包括:
获取密钥分发中心公开的系统参数;
获取可信机构公开的第一参数,通过安全信道将私钥skCU和skTA分别发送给云用户和可信机构;
根据所述系统参数、用户的私钥和所述第一参数,生成用户待存储数据对应的带有隐私保护的标签;所述用户的私钥由所述密钥分发中心根据所述用户的身份生成;
将所述待存储数据和所述带有隐私保护的标签发送至云服务提供商进行云存储;
获取所述用户公开的第二参数;
云服务提供商根据所述系统参数、所述第一参数和所述第二参数对云存储的数据进行完整性验证;
第三方审计根据用户的委托,对所述云存储的数据进行完整性验证;
当所述云服务提供商向所述可信机构请求所述用户待存储数据的真实标签时,所述可信机构根据所述可信机构的私钥和所述第二参数,对所述用户待存储数据对应的带有隐私保护的标签利用公式进行计算,得到所述用户待存储数据对应的真实标签σi'。
2.根据权利要求1所述的云存储标签隐私保护的数据完整性检测方法,其特征在于,所述获取密钥分发中心公开的系统参数,之后还包括:
用户向所述密钥分发中心提交用户身份ID,得到所述密钥分发中心返回的用户的私钥;
可信机构向所述密钥分发中心提交可信机构身份ID,得到所述密钥分发中心返回的可信机构的私钥。
3.根据权利要求1所述的云存储标签隐私保护的数据完整性检测方法,其特征在于,所述根据所述系统参数、用户的私钥和所述第一参数,生成对用户待存储数据进行隐私保护的标签,具体包括:
将所述待存储数据分为多个数据块;
根据所述第一参数,随机生成第二参数和第三参数;
对于每个数据块,根据所述系统参数和所述用户的私钥,生成可验证的标签;
根据所述第三参数和每个数据块的可验证的标签,生成每个数据块对应的带有隐私保护的标签;
将每个数据块对应的隐私保护的标签组成的集合确定为所述用户待存储数据进行隐私保护的标签。
4.根据权利要求1所述的云存储标签隐私保护的数据完整性检测方法,其特征在于,所述第三方审计根据用户的委托,对所述云存储的数据进行完整性验证,具体包括:
根据所述用户待存储的数据,所述第三方审计生成挑战请求;
所述云服务提供商根据所述挑战请求、所述云存储的数据和所述云存储的数据对应的标签,生成完整性证据;
所述第三方审计根据所述第一参数和所述第二参数,对所述完整性证据进行有效性验证;
当所述完整性证据有效时,确定所述云存储的数据完整;
当所述完整性证据无效时,确定所述云存储的数据不完整。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于桂林电子科技大学,未经桂林电子科技大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010386096.5/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种视频播放方法及装置
- 下一篇:一种导热润滑脂及其制备方法和应用





